Around the building
The Point is fully wheelchair accessible with flat level access to our Box Office and all performance spaces. There is a lift to our meeting room and wheelchair accessible seating areas.
We have three accessible toilets.
Walking sticks, crutches and walking aids can be taken into any of our performance spaces. We also have spaces for mobility vehicles.
If you are bringing a pram or buggy to a show, please let us know so we can arrange storage for you.

Hearing Assistance
We offer two different types of infra-red hearing systems for enhanced hearing:
A headset for anyone who would like the sound on stage amplified
A necklace set to amplify sound on stage for those people who already wear a hearing aid.

Relaxed performances
Our relaxed performances create a warm welcome to people who might normally find it difficult attending the theatre.
This can include: people with learning disabilities, movement disorders, Autistic Spectrum Disorder, other sensory, communication or neurological conditions, or those with young children or babies.
At our relaxed performances you'll find:
Free personal assistant tickets to ensure audiences feel supported and have the richest theatre experience possible
Extra staff help with seating and access around the theatre
The lighting will be a little higher during the performance
No blackouts or strobe lighting
Our staff and the actors will have a relaxed attitude to noise (both voluntary and involuntary)
You can leave the auditorium at any point with staff to help you leave safely
Additional wheelchair spaces
